Historic courthouse listed on the National Register of Historic Places (NRHP).

Built: 1933-1934
Architect: Bassham & Wheeler (Fort Smith, AR)
Architectural style: Art Deco
Areas of significance: Architecture
Area: less than 1 acre
Date added to NRHP: 11/13/1989
Other designations: contributing property to the Waldron Commercial Historic District
Notes: This courthouse was constructed by the Works Progress Administration, a New Deal program that operated between 1935 and 1943. The program provided work for unemployed people who were struggling to find jobs during the Great Depression.
